On Jan. 24, 2025, at approximately 5:15 p.m., deputies from the Montgomery County Sheriff’s Office District 2 Patrol responded to a report of a robbery in progress at the Wendy’s restaurant on Sawdust Road.
Deputies arrived promptly at the scene and apprehended the suspect, identified as Nicholas Xavier Rivas, while he was allegedly still committing the robbery.
Rivas, a documented gang member from Houston, Texas, was arrested without further incident and transported to the Montgomery County Jail.
Rivas has been charged with felony robbery and is being held on a $75,000 bond.
According to a statement from Montgomery County Sheriff’s Office, “The swift actions of these deputies send a clear message to gang members who believe they can come to Montgomery County and commit violent crimes: such lawlessness will not be tolerated. Those who engage in criminal activity will be arrested and prosecuted, and justice will be served.”
